ALCHEMY (RRID:SCR_005761) ALCHEMY source code, software resource ALCHEMY is a genotype calling algorithm for Affymetrix and Illumina products which is not based on clustering methods. Features include explicit handling of reduced heterozygosity due to inbreeding and accurate results with small sample sizes. ALCHEMY is a method for automated calling of diploid genotypes from raw intensity data produced by various high-throughput multiplexed SNP genotyping methods. It has been developed for and tested on Affymetrix GeneChip Arrays, Illumina GoldenGate, and Illumina Infinium based assays. Primary motivations for ALCHEMY''s development was the lack of available genotype calling methods which can perform well in the absence of heterozygous samples (due to panels of inbred lines being genotyped) or provide accurate calls with small sample batches. ALCHEMY differs from other genotype calling methods in that genotype inference is based on a parametric Bayesian model of the raw intensity data rather than a generalized clustering approach and the model incorporates population genetic principles such as Hardy-Weinberg equilibrium adjusted for inbreeding levels. ALCHEMY can simultaneously estimate individual sample inbreeding coefficients from the data and use them to improve statistical inference of diploid genotypes at individual SNPs. The main documentation for ALCHEMY is maintained on the sourceforge-hosted MediaWiki system. Features * Population genetic model based SNP genotype calling * Simultaneous estimation of per-sample inbreeding coefficients, allele frequencies, and genotypes * Bayesian model provides posterior probabilities of genotype correctness as quality measures * Growing number of scripts and supporting programs for validation of genotypes against control data and output reformating needs * Multithreaded program for parallel execution on multi-CPU/core systems * Non-clustering based methods can handle small sample sets for empirical optimization of sample preparation techniques and accurate calling of SNPs missing genotype classes ALCHEMY is written in C and developed on the GNU/Linux platform. It should compile on any current GNU/Linux distribution with the development packages for the GNU Scientific Library (gsl) and other development packages for standard system libraries. It may also compile and run on Mac OS X if gsl is installed. diploid, genotype, snp, bio.tools is listed by: bio.tools

OWL API (RRID:SCR_005734) OWL API source code, software resource The OWL API is a Java API and reference implementation for creating, manipulating and serializing OWL Ontologies. The latest version of the API is focused towards OWL 2. The OWLAPI underpins ontology browsing and editing tools and platforms such as SWOOP and Protege4. Note that this API, or any other OWL-based API, can be used without an integrated OWL parser if you download a pre-converted OWL file generated from OBO. See OBO Ontologies List for all OBO ontologies converted to OWL (we do not list the full complement of OWL-based APIs here, only those of direct relevance to GO). The OWL API includes the following components: * An API for OWL 2 and an efficient in-memory reference implementation * RDF/XML parser and writer * OWL/XML parser and writer * OWL Functional Syntax parser and writer * Turtle parser and writer * KRSS parser * OBO Flat file format parser * Reasoner interfaces for working with reasoners such as FaCT++, HermiT, Pellet and Racer Platform: Windows compatible, Mac OS X compatible, Linux compatible, Unix compatible ontology, owl, api, java, software library, parser, writer is listed by: Gene Ontology Tools

OrChem (RRID:SCR_008865) OrChem source code, software resource OrChem is an extension for the Oracle 11G database that adds registration and indexing of chemical structures to support fast substructure and similarity searching. The cheminformatics functionality is provided by the Chemistry Development Kit. OrChem provides similarity searching with response times in the order of seconds for databases with millions of compounds, depending on a given similarity cut-off. For substructure searching, it can make use of multiple processor cores on today''s powerful database servers to provide fast response times in equally large data sets. OrChem is an Oracle chemistry plug-in using the Chemistry Development Kit (CDK). The CDK is an open source Java library for Chemoinformatics and Bioinformatics. OrChem is maintained by the chemoinformatics and metabolism team of the European Bioinformatics Institute. Oracle Data cartridges extend the capabilities of the Oracle server. For chemistry various commercial cartridges exist that facilitate searching and analyzing chemical data. OrChem also provides functionality like this, but is not a cartridge. It doesn''t need Oracle''s extensibility architecture because its Java components run as Java stored procedures inside the Oracle standard JVM (Aurora). OrChem is suitable for Oracle 11G and onwards. Starting with Oracle 11g release 1 (11.1) there is a just-in-time(JIT) compiler for Oracle JVM environment. A JIT compiler for Oracle JVM enables much faster execution because it manages the invalidation, recompilation, and storage of code without an external mechanism. This new Oracle feature makes Java classes perform better than before. oracle, chemistry, cdk, similarity search, chemical structure, cheminformatics, bioinformatics, plugin is listed by: 3DVC

iso2mesh (RRID:SCR_013202) iso2mesh software application, software toolkit, software resource A Matlab / Octave-based mesh generation toolbox designed for easy creation of high quality surface and tetrahedral meshes from 3D volumetric images. It contains a rich set of mesh processing scripts/programs, functioning independently or interfacing with external free meshing utilities. Iso2mesh toolbox can operate directly on 3D binary, segmented or gray-scale images, such as those from MRI or CT scans, making it particularly suitable for multi-modality medical imaging data analysis or multi-physics modeling. matlab, mesh generation, modeling, magnetic resonance, optical imaging, os independent, mri, computed tomography, octave is listed by: NeuroImaging Tools and Resources Collaboratory (NITRC)

BamView (RRID:SCR_004207) BamView source code, software resource A free interactive display of read alignments in BAM data files that can be launched with Java Web Start or downloaded. This interactive Java application for visualizing the large amounts of data stored for sequence reads which are aligned against a reference genome sequence can be used in a number of contexts including SNP calling and structural annotation. It has been integrated into Artemis so that the reads can be viewed in the context of the nucleotide sequence and genomic features. The source code is available as part of the Artemis code which can be downloaded from GitHub. bam, next-generation sequencing, java, snp calling, structural annotation, macosx, unix, windows, visualize, analyze, sequence read, reference sequence, single nucleotide polymorphism, bio.tools is listed by: OMICtools

Multivariate Analysis of Transcript Splicing (RRID:SCR_013049) MATS data analysis software, software application, software resource, data processing software Software tool to detect differential alternative splicing events from RNA-Seq data. Calculates P value and false discovery rate that difference in isoform ratio of gene between two conditions exceeds given user defined threshold. Can automatically detect and analyze alternative splicing events corresponding to all major types of alternative splicing patterns. Handles replicate RNA-Seq data from both paired and unpaired study design. SPInDel (RRID:SCR_004509) SPInDel data set, data or information resource, software resource A multifunctional workbench for species identification using insertion/deletion variants. The SPInDel workbench provides a step-by-step environment for the alignment of target sequences, selection of informative hypervariable regions, design of PCR primers and the statistical validation of the species-identification process. It includes a large dataset comprising nearly 1,800 numeric profiles for the identification of eukaryotic, prokaryotic and viral species. virus, indel, dna barcoding, alignment, nucleotide sequence, visualization, conserved region, pcr primer, phylogenetic, variant is listed by: OMICtools
